Spiced Apple Smoothie

Prep Time: 5 minutes

Yield: 1 smoothie

Serving Size: 12 ounces

This Spiced Apple Smoothie is not only filling, but full of autumn flavors!

Ingredients

  • 1 medium banana, peeled and sliced
  • 3/4 cup cup greek yogurt
  • 1/2 cup almond milk
  • 1/4 cup applesauce
  • 2 tablespoons apple butter
  • 2 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 1 teaspoon Autumn Spice Blend

Instructions

  1. Place all ingredients in blender and blend until smooth and creamy.
